Logo
ExecutivePlacements.com

Senior Software Engineer - Video Rendering Job at ExecutivePlacements.com in San

ExecutivePlacements.com, San Mateo, CA, United States, 94409

Save Job

San Mateo, CA, United States - ID: 5566

Every day, tens of millions of people come to Roblox to explore, create, play, learn, and connect with friends in 3D immersive digital experiences all created by our global community of developers and creators.

At Roblox, we’re building the tools and platform that empower our community to bring any experience they can imagine to life. Our vision is to reimagine the way people come together, from anywhere in the world, and on any device.

We are seeking an experienced Android Video Engineer to join the Video Team. This role focuses on adaptive video playback and rendering, screen recording, camera capture, live video, video ads, video transcoding, and moderation across mobile, desktop, consoles, and web.

Responsibilities

  • Design, develop, optimize, and debug video capture, encoding, playback, and rendering focused on the Android platform using NDK APIs like Vulkan and AMediaCodec.
  • Innovate, architect, and implement our vision for video in a 3D immersive environment.
  • Work across all platforms—including desktop, mobile, and consoles—to integrate video capabilities.
  • Contribute to backend microservices related to video processing.
  • Collaborate with cross‑functional teams across Roblox to develop new uses of video.
  • Be guided to create state‑of‑the‑art video technology for the gaming industry.

Qualifications

  • 5+ years of experience designing, developing, and debugging complex C++ applications running on Android.
  • Expertise across a wide variety of Android devices.
  • Proficient with Vulkan or OpenGL on Android in a performance‑oriented environment.
  • Strong knowledge of video codecs (AVC, HEVC, AV1) and compression, delivery, and decoding pipelines; familiarity with YUV, HLS, and related concepts.
  • Passion for learning new technologies as the video landscape evolves.

Employment Details

  • Location: San Mateo, CA (Hybrid – onsite Tuesday, Wednesday, and Thursday, optional Monday and Friday)
  • Employment Type: Full‑time
  • Seniority Level: Mid‑Senior
  • Job Function: Engineering and Information Technology
#J-18808-Ljbffr